Shaoxing, as a cradle of talents, characterizes a large of number of celebrities and scholars who played a key role in Chinese history.
Men of talents came forth in succession. The number of top scholars in both arts and military totaled 27 and Jinshi-- the successful candidates in the highest imperial examination, totaled 2238. There were also four Shaoxing-based presidents of Peking University and 73 academicians of the two academies.
